Marshmallow Caramel Crunch Balls Ingredients
For the Crunch Balls
- Marshmallows – Use mini marshmallows for the best melting and blending, ensuring a gooey texture.
- Caramel Bits – Opt for soft baking caramels to add rich flavor and achieve a smooth melt, perfect for binding.
- Sweetened Condensed Milk – This ingredient enhances creaminess and moisture, making it indispensable in this recipe.
- Butter – Use unsalted butter to increase richness and prevent sticking during the caramel melting process.
- Rice Krispie Cereal – Adds crunch and lightness; feel free to substitute with crispy cereal or chopped nuts if desired for variety.

Step‑by‑Step Instructions for Marshmallow Caramel Crunch Balls
Step 1: Prepare the Marshmallows
Insert toothpicks into each mini marshmallow and place them upright on a parchment-lined sheet pan. This setup will allow for easier dipping later, ensuring that your Marshmallow Caramel Crunch Balls maintain their shape. Completing this step should take about 10 minutes.
Step 2: Set Up the Cereal
In a large mixing bowl, pour in the rice krispie cereal and set it aside. This crunchy base will give your treats the delightful texture that complements the softness of the marshmallows and the gooey caramel. Make sure it’s ready for coating after the caramel dip!
Step 3: Melt the Caramel Mixture
In a microwave-safe bowl, combine the caramel bits, sweetened condensed milk, and unsalted butter. Heat this mixture in the microwave in 30-second increments, stirring vigorously after each interval. Continue until the mixture is smooth and creamy, which should take about 1.5 to 2 minutes total.
Step 4: Coat the Marshmallows
Dip each marshmallow into the melted caramel mixture, allowing the excess caramel to drip back into the bowl. Then, immediately coat the caramel-covered marshmallow in the rice krispie cereal, ensuring an even layer. Place each coated marshmallow back on the parchment-lined pan, ready for the next step.
Step 5: Set the Crunch Balls
Once all marshmallows are coated with caramel and crispies, let them cool for about 30 minutes at room temperature. This time allows the caramel to set, creating a firm exterior on your Marshmallow Caramel Crunch Balls that holds the crunchiness inside.
Step 6: Final Touches
After they have cooled, gently remove the toothpicks from the Marshmallow Caramel Crunch Balls. For an extra touch, consider drizzling melted chocolate over the top or rolling them in colorful sprinkles, making them not only a treat for the taste buds but also a feast for the eyes!

How to Store and Freeze Marshmallow Caramel Crunch Balls
Room Temperature: Keep the Marshmallow Caramel Crunch Balls in an airtight container at room temperature for up to one week to maintain their delightful texture.
Fridge: If you prefer a firmer texture, you can store them in the fridge; however, consume within 5 days for optimal flavor and freshness.
Freezer: For longer storage, freeze the formed balls individually on a baking sheet. Once solid, transfer them to an airtight container, where they can be stored for up to two months.
Reheating: There’s no need to reheat these treats; simply allow them to thaw at room temperature before enjoying, ensuring they retain their chewy and crunchy goodness!

What can I do if the caramel is too runny?
If you find your caramel mixture is runny, no need to worry! Let it cool for a few minutes before dipping the marshmallows. This slight cooling allows it to thicken a bit, giving you better coating. If you still encounter issues, consider adding a little more caramel bits or butter and reheating gently.
